Prime MinÂisÂter KamÂla PerÂsad-BissesÂsar says OpÂpoÂsiÂtion Leader PenÂneÂlope BeckÂles is “the last one to talk about quesÂtionÂable charÂacÂters” withÂin the UnitÂed NaÂtionÂal ConÂgress’ (UNC) ranks.
The Prime MinÂisÂter’s reÂsponse came a day afÂter BeckÂles called on her (PerÂsad-BissesÂsar) to leave her alone reÂgardÂing her deÂciÂsion on the fate of SenÂaÂtor Janelle John-Bates, sayÂing the PNM leader should inÂstead “deal with her own probÂlems.”
BeckÂles made the comÂment durÂing the PNM’s Sports and FamÂiÂly Day in Port-of-Spain on SunÂday.
